Preparation, Characterization And Adsorption Performance Study Of Tetrahydropalmatine Molecularly Imprinted Polymers Containing Phenanthrene Ring Skeleton

In this paper, MIP containing skeleton of phenanthrene ring were prepared by suspension polymerization, using THP as the template, ethylene glycol maleic rosinate acrylate as crosslinker, and methacrylic acid (MAA) as the functional monomer. The preparation, characterization and adsorption performance of MIP is studied. The main work of this study is shown as follows:The feasibility of molecular imprinting was tested by UV-vis and FT-IR spectroscopy analysis. Tetrahydropalmatine molecularly imprinted polymers had been prepared by suspension polymerization. The optimal polymerization conditions were as follows:the cross linker was ethylene glycol malefic rosinate acrylate, the functional monomer was methacrylic acid, the molar ratio of template:cross linker:monomer was0.1:1:3, the concentration of monomers was1.08mol·L-1, the porogen was15%(v/v) in the organic solvent, the dispersion agent was sodium dodecyl sulfate (SDS), the stirring rate was800r·min-1, the reaction temperature was95℃and the reaction time was1h. The MIP were characterized with FT-IR, scanning electron microscopy (SEM), nitrogen surface area analyzer and Thermo Gravimetric Analyze. The results showed that there are no the template in the MIP, moreover, the MIP were loose, macroporous and sable.Several important factors that influenced adsorption of the imprinted polymer were explored by static binding assay. The binding characteristics and selectivity of the imprinted polymer were also studied. The optimal adsorption conditions were as follows:the size of polymer particles were250-380μm, the time of adsorption equilibrium was4.5h, the frequency of oscillation was150r·min-1, the temperature of adsorption process was30℃.The adsorption rate of the polymers was in coincidence with Langergen quasi-second order kinetics model and the adsorption isotherms of the polymers showed that the sorption quantity of the MIP was much larger than that of the NMIP. The selectivity adsorption showed that the obtained MIP possessed high selectivity towards the template. The MIP was used to concentrate and purify tetrahydropalmatine.The optimal conditions were obtained by studying the desorption of tetrahydropalmatine molecularly imprinted polymers. The results showed that the desorption rate was over90%by using0.1%HCl·C2H5OH to desorp0.5h. After the MIP being used20times, its absorption capability did not become obviously weak. It was proved that the prepared MIP had excellent stability. The polymer microspheres could be used in cycle.
